Focus Point Precision - Focus appears slightly closer to the sunglasses than the near eye. - For portraits, the nearest eye must be tack sharp.👉 Solution: Use single-point AF on the eye or eye-detect AF. - 2. Crop & Composition - The crop is slightly tight on the top and arm. - The elbow/arm cut feels a little abrupt.👉 Improvement options: - Crop slightly higher for a tighter head-and-shoulders lookOR - Pull back a touch to include more arm for balance. 3. Hand Position - The hand is expressive but slightly dominant. - Fingers are well-shaped, but the gesture could be a touch softer.👉 Tip: Ask subject to relax fingers or barely touch the glasses. 4. Background Highlights - Bright circular highlights on the left edge draw mild attention.👉 Fix in-camera: - Shift angle slightly - Use subject placement to avoid highlight clusters👉 Fix in post: - Subtle vignette or highlight reduction
